General Summary Under direction, provides telephone customer service and triage to individuals who call Macomb County Community Mental Health (MCCMH) for mental health, substance abuse and/or developmental disability services. Collects demographic information, verifies insurance, provides community resources and information related to MCCMH programs and services. Essential Functions and Responsibilities Gathers information to determine the appropriate course of action for the call. Transfers calls to MCCMH Crisis Center, Managed Care Operations (MCO), and other related departments. Provides information on walk in provider clinics. Connects individuals to MCO for screening and access to services. Completes triage screens per initial telephonic contact with individuals served. Gathers and completes data entry of insurance information into electronic medical records (EMR). Meets established telephonic standards and benchmarks. Conducts outreach calls. Provides resources and referrals to community agencies. Operates an automobile to perform assigned job functions. Performs other duties as assigned.
